Summary: | Objective. Determination of the degree of development of various types of microorganisms and their effect on the physical and mechanical properties of concrete.Method. Assessment of the possibility of concrete to serve as a substrate for various types of biodestructors was carried out using the determination of moisture absorption and pH of water drawing of concrete samples.Result. Experimental mechanism of action of various microorganisms on concrete is established. Taxonomic composition of microorganisms most aggressive to concrete is determined. The impact of biofouling on the physical and mechanical properties of concrete was assessed.Conclusion. The results of the investigation serve as the basis for competent selection of the most effective methods of corrosion protection of concrete structures operating in biologically aggressive environments. |
